Chainlink has added 10 new integrations across five services and four blockchain networks, expanding its infrastructure across DeFi, payments, cross-chain applications, data, and AI-related projects.
The latest update includes Aave, Bottomline Pay, Forever Money AI, GM Trade, Space and Time, Tempo and World. Chainlink announced the latest integrations on X, highlighting the different projects using its infrastructure for market data, blockchain interoperability, payments, and other on-chain applications.

CCIP Connects Cross-Chain Applications
Chainlink’s Cross-Chain Interoperability Protocol (CCIP) is also part of the latest integrations. Forever Money AI recently expanded its 1:1 native TAO access to Robinhood Chain using Chainlink’s CCIP.
The integration provides cross-chain access to the Bittensor ecosystem while using Chainlink’s security architecture.
Bottomline Pay is another project using Chainlink technology for blockchain-based payments. According to Chainlink, the company works with more than 600 banks and processes more than $16 trillion in payments each year.
The partnership combines CCIP with Chainlink Runtime Environment to support payment workflows across blockchain networks.
Space and Time Uses Chainlink for Privacy
Space and Time has adopted Chainlink’s privacy technology for its Virtual Vaults. The system allows users to prove information about collateral held across private venues without exposing the underlying positions or the borrower’s identity.
This gives lending applications a way to verify information while keeping sensitive financial data private. The integration adds a privacy use case to the latest Chainlink expansion, alongside the network’s existing data and interoperability services.
Chainlink’s Latest Integrations Span Several Use Cases
The 10 new integrations cover more than price data and DeFi applications. Payments, cross-chain transfers, privacy, and financial data are also represented in the latest group.
Chainlink’s infrastructure includes several services that support these applications:
- Data Feeds: Market and financial data for blockchain applications
- CCIP: Cross-chain transfers and messaging
- Automation: Automated on-chain actions
- Data Streams: Low-latency market data
- Proof of Reserve: On-chain verification of asset reserves
The latest update provides a snapshot of how different blockchain projects use Chainlink services for specific technical needs.
